1. Understand the Psychology of Office Paint Colors

In the world of office painting, not all colors are created equal. Certain colors have been proven to stimulate specific moods and behaviors, making them more suitable for different types of workspaces.

For instance, green and blue, known as calming colors, are excellent choices for spaces where concentration is key, like a design studio or a law firm. On the other hand, vibrant hues like yellow and red can energize and stimulate creativity, making them perfect for advertising agencies or startups. When it comes to office paint colors, understand the psychology behind them to make the most effective choice.

2. Choose a Theme: One of the Most Important Office Painting Ideas

One of the most impactful office painting ideas is to choose a theme. A theme can guide your color choice and overall design direction, ensuring a cohesive look.

Perhaps you want a modern, minimalist office with a monochromatic color palette. Or, you may prefer a vibrant, eclectic office with a mix of bold colors and patterns. Whichever you choose, your office painting theme should reflect your company’s brand and values.

3. Incorporate Wall Painting Ideas

Wall painting ideas can add character and depth to your office space. For instance, you could create an accent wall with a contrasting color, or use wallpaper with a unique pattern or texture. Murals, particularly those that embody the spirit of the company, can be an inspiring touch to the workspace.

Another innovative wall painting idea is the use of chalkboard or whiteboard paint. This not only adds a fun, interactive element to your office, but also serves as a functional space for brainstorming sessions or reminders.

4. Don’t Forget About Practicality

While aesthetics are essential in office painting, practicality should not be overlooked. For instance, lighter colors can make small spaces seem larger and more open, while darker shades can make large, open spaces feel more intimate and cozy.

Moreover, high-traffic areas may benefit from semi-gloss or gloss paint, as they are easier to clean and more resistant to wear and tear. Consider the function of each area in your office when deciding on your office paint colors.
